Too Busy Not to Pray

For the past twenty years this classic on prayer has been helping Christians all over the world slow down to draw near to God.  During those years, the world certainly hasn’t slowed down.  If anything, the pace, intensity and number of distractions have only increased.  Brokenness and pain in our lives and in the world seem to have increased as well.  The urgent need for prayer is clear, but busyness still keeps many of us from finding time to pray.

Two truths haven’t changed in twenty years:  God is the same powerful, just, holy God he’s always been.  And true prayer—prayer that changes and allows us to participate in God’s work in the world-can’t happen on the fly.  So Bill Hybels offers us his practical, time-tested ideas on slowing down to pray.  Too Busy Not to Pray broadens our vision for what our eternal, powerful God does when his people slow down to pray.

This is a book discussion with some occasional study of the Scriptures.   Involves approximately 2 hours of weekly preparation.  Regular committed preparation and attendance is encouraged. This study will meet for 11 weeks. Fee: $13.

Marriage Course

The Marriage Course is a marriage enrichment program designed to build, strengthen, and even mend marriages. Over eight evenings, couples have the opportunity to discuss important issues often ignored in the rush of life.

Topics covered include the following:

    • Learning to communicate effectively
    • Resolving conflict
    • Healing past hurts
    • Recognizing each other’s needs
    • Making each other feel loved
    • Realizing the importance of good sex
    • Handling relationships with parents and in-laws
    • Having fun together

All discussions are private between husband and wife.  There is no group work involved at any stage of the course. On January 16, we will begin at 6:00pm with a complimentary dinner. All other evenings, dessert will be provided based on a voluntary rotation of participants. Fee: $25 per couple.
